轉載 略談GCHandle C# - Marshal.StructureToPtr方法簡介 Marshal類 兩個方法StructureToPtr和PtrToStructure實現序列化 字節 數組 轉換 ...
MemoryCache在項目中用了很久,感覺比較簡單,以前也看過里面的源代碼,主要借用MemoryCacheStore來完成數據的存儲,里面是線程安全的,MemoryCacheStore借用Hashtable來實現存儲,如果已經有數據了,就把以前的刪除然后在添加 我們來看看MemoryCache的實現: MemoryCacheStore的實現: 可見MemoryCache和MemoryCacheS ...
2018-03-19 19:34 0 892 推薦指數:
轉載 略談GCHandle C# - Marshal.StructureToPtr方法簡介 Marshal類 兩個方法StructureToPtr和PtrToStructure實現序列化 字節 數組 轉換 ...
Technorati 標簽: C# 轉載自csdn:http://blog.csdn.net/robingaoxb/article/details/6199514 我們在使用c#托管代碼時,內存地址和GC回收那不是我們關心的,CLR已經給我們暗箱操作。 但是如果我們在c#中調用 ...
很多情況下需要用到緩存,合理利用緩存一方面可以提高程序的響應速度,同時可以減少對特定資源訪問的壓力。為了避免每次請求都去訪問后台的資源(例如數據庫),一般會考慮將一些更新不是很頻繁的、可以重用 ...
using System; using System.Collections.Generic; using System.Linq; using System.Runtime.Caching; ...
1 借鑒這篇文章 https://www.cnblogs.com/zuowj/p/8440902.html ...
引用類庫 1.Install-Package Microsoft.Extensions.Caching.Memory MemoryCacheOptions 緩存配置 1.ExpirationSc ...
參考資料:long0801的博客、MemoryCache微軟官方文檔 添加對Microsoft.Extensions.Caching.Memory命名空間的引用,它提供了.NET Core默認實現的MemoryCache類,以及全新的內存緩存API 代碼如下: ...
前言 是這么一回事: 我正在苦思一個業務邏輯,捋着我還剩不多的秀發,一時陷入冥想中...... 突然聊天圖標一頓猛閃,打開一看,有同事語音; 大概意思是:同事把項目中Redis部分緩存換成MemoryCache/Memcached,還強調MemoryCache/Memcached ...